122024361211 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 122024361212. Its totient is φ = 122024361210.

The previous prime is 122024361209. The next prime is 122024361269. The reversal of 122024361211 is 112163420221.

It is a weak pr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 122024361211 - 21 = 122024361209 is a prime.

Together with 122024361209, it forms a pair of twin primes.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(122024361281)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 61012180605 + 61012180606.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(61012180606).

Almost surely, 2122024361211 is an apocalyptic number.

122024361211 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

122024361211 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

122024361211 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1152, while the sum is 25.

Adding to 122024361211 its reverse (112163420221), we get a palindrome (234187781432).

The spelling of 122024361211 in words is "one hundred twenty-two billion, twenty-four million, three hundred sixty-one thousand, two hundred eleven".
